I think i am gonna cry. Over the weekend i left my computer at work imaging another MacBook Pro. I come in thismorning and my laptop was off and woould not wake up. The MBP that i was imaging was done and boots fine. My laptop will not boot to the hard drive. I boot to CD and it still won't see th drive to repair via Disk Utility. I can't get to target disc mode. nada. My drive will not boot in another macbook. i am sorta freaking out cause it was my work laptop. So i have questions

1. Any other ways to recover the data myself
2. Recommendatons for a company to do the recovery.

You could try putting the drive in either another Mac laptop or into a 2.5" external case. Either of these might give you more luck recovering your data, depending on why this happened in the first place. Good luck! :)
